src/clpp11.hpp: avoid throwing exceptions from std::shared_ptr's Deleter

+// Error occured in OpenCL (no-exception version for destructors)
+inline void CheckErrorDtor(const cl_int status) {
+ if (status != CL_SUCCESS) {
+ auto message = "Internal OpenCL Error: "+std::to_string(status) + " (ignoring)";
+ fprintf(stderr, "%s\n", message.c_str());
+ }
+}
